How to see it

HIP 13180 has a visual magnitude of about 8.25: it usually needs binoculars or a small telescope, especially from light-polluted sites.

Sky position

Equatorial coordinates for HIP 13180: right ascension 2h 49m 35s, declination +36° 48′ 29″ (J2000), in the region of the Perseus constellation (IAU figure Per).
